Delhi-NCR’s first Multimodal Active Memory and Dementia Centre Launched in Gurgaon

New Delhi : Delhi- NCR gets its first state of the art active memory and dementia centre which was inaugurated on Sunday by Dr. N k Jain, Retd. Director Health, Government of Haryana in presence of  Sunita Duggal, Member of Parliament, Sirsa.

This memory and dementia centre will play a big role in the lives of individuals living with dementia and their families and will address the pressing challenges of dementia.   Doctors, trained psychologists and social workers will be at the forefront of addressing patients’ needs, providing empathetic and informed assistance.

This Memory and Dementia Centre will provide a comprehensive expert-led cognitive assessment platform for the elderly. The initiative is aimed at supporting families and persons with dementia through post-diagnostic care and support. While there is a huge dearth of memory clinics, psychiatrists, geriatricians and neurologists  in our country, this centre is  expected to help those with dementia and their families get timely diagnosis and expert advice for post diagnosis clinical management.

This Centre has been launched under “Bhul na Jana Campaign” which is  said to be India’s biggest campaign on Dementia awareness and management, which recently launched free national dementia helpline number 9818687903.

Dr. Praveen Gupta, renowned neurologist under whose advisory role this centre will function said “ Vata Vriksh Memory Centre will work for early diagnosis of Memory Loss, Dementia and Alzheimer’s cases which remains under-diagnosed in elderly. The first part of the solution is to raise awareness and then make facilities accessible to more patients in need. This centre will offers comprehensive management of dementia including cognitive rehabilitation and caregiver support for persons with dementia. We are planning to open more such memory centres in future to manage dementia cases which is rising at a fast pace”.

This Centre has been named as  “Vata Vriksh ”and will be under the leadership of Dr. Ramesh Goyal and Dr. Deepti Goyal  who after rigorous training in senior care in United States, established “Vata Vriksh Centre” in Gurgaon.The Name is inspired by the life-sustaining qualities of the Banyan Tree (Vata Vriksh).
